 IMSIU Signs MoU with Artificial Intelligence Governance Association to Strengthen Research and AI Governance Cooperation

     To enhance cooperation in scientific research, training, and the exchange of expertise in artificial intelligence governance, Imam Mohammad Ibn Saud Islamic University signed a Memorandum of Understanding with the Artificial Intelligence Governance Association.

 


     Represented by the Vice Presidency for Graduate Studies and Scientific Research, the University signed the memorandum on Sunday, February 15, 2026, as part of its efforts to strengthen strategic partnerships with specialized national entities and advance cooperation in scientific, research, training, and advisory fields.

 


     The memorandum was signed on behalf of the University by Naif M. Al-Otaibi, Vice President for Graduate Studies and Scientific Research, while the Association was represented by Dhabiya A. Al-Buainain, Chair of the Board of Directors.

 


     The memorandum aims to enhance collaboration in joint research projects; organize meetings, conferences, seminars, and workshops in academic and research fields; and facilitate the exchange of scientific, academic, and technical expertise. It also includes cooperation in developing faculty members' scientific and professional competencies, supporting artificial intelligence governance and its contemporary applications.

 


     Additionally, the memorandum covers cooperation in implementing specialized scientific and awareness initiatives and programs in artificial intelligence governance. This will contribute to disseminating specialized knowledge, strengthening national capacity in emerging technological fields, and advancing the research and innovation environment.

 


     This memorandum reflects the University's ongoing commitment to building high-quality partnerships with specialized national entities, strengthening alignment between educational outcomes and future sector needs, supporting institutional excellence and innovation, and contributing to the objectives of Saudi Vision 2030.
